After 24 years I have decided to seek interest for the sale of the FishnHunt forum. I am now retired and traveling a lot so just don't have the time to put into it. This has not been an easy decision as the forum has been my baby for 24 years and I have made so many great friends over the years.
There is a reasonable income to be had without doing anything, however it could provide a good full-time living for an enterprising outdoors person . Anyone interested please email me alan@fishnhunt.co.nz and I will send them an information sheet. www.fishnhunt.co.nz/forum/YaBB.cgi
